Transaction 596e3884b49d3c8d134a6e762158e77d295153cc44649e99d301bdd33d847bac
1 Input
1 Output
-
596e3884b49d3c8d134a6e762158e77d295153cc44649e99d301bdd33d847bac:0
- value
- 33053
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 87f736d95c2f19ad43d48b6e559cfdb7936aae4f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DPvNePUsi8QAcC8f8FZmA2TAjdF5xpCKB